After seeing Netflix fans become totally consumed with private zoo owner/convicted criminal Joe Exotic and his rival Carole Baskin, a Florida sheriff just called for new tips in the disappearance of Carole’s late husband, Don Lewis.

A quick refresher on Carole and Don: Don was a millionaire who left his wife and kids to be with Carole. In 1997, Don went missing and Carole reported it to the police. Soon after, Don’s van was found at the airport, so many people speculated he took one of his private planes on an uncharted trip to Costa Rica. Nothing came of the investigation. But since Carole owns Big Cat Rescue, an organization that seeks to end abuse and captivity of big cats, and posed a threat to Joe Exotic’s livelihood, Joe began to circulate claims that Carole was involved in Don’s death. Joe even released a music video implying that Carole fed Don’s body to her tigers, which she refuted.

Since this case remains unsolved, Hillsborough County Sheriff Chad Chronister capitalized on all this new interest and called for tips. He tweeted, “Since @Netflix and #Covid19 #Quarantine has made #TigerKing all the rage, I figured it was a good time to ask for new leads.” Appreciate the hustle.

Earlier this month, Tiger King directors Rebecca Chaiklin and Eric Goode spoke with Esquire about the difficulties they faced when investigating Don’s disappearance. Chaiklin said, “We’ve done so many things that we were trying to follow up on, and there’s just such a lack of evidence that it’s really difficult to pursue it further.”
